It’s National Apprenticeship Week 2023! The Coders Guild is proud to celebrate apprentices everywhere over the course of #NAW23.

National Apprenticeship Week only comes around once a year, and it's an opportunity for the education and skills sectors to celebrate the achievements of apprentices from all around the country and the positive impact they make to communities, businesses and the wider economy.

The Coders Guild will be kicking off the week participating in the incredible annual Leeds Apprenticeship Recruitment Fair at the First Direct Arena, Leeds. This is an event we’ve had the honour of being a part of for the last two years now (and before the pandemic) and every year it's such an exciting event for one amazing reason; we get to meet you! We get to speak to you all and answer any questions that you may have about apprenticeships.

The Coders Guild at Leeds Apprenticeship Recruitment Fair 2022.

Every year we get excited for NAW because it means we get to meet and speak to hundreds of people, from countless backgrounds, all about the benefits of apprenticeships and how they work.
